Ticket QV-2184: Replace homegrown job queue with Relayline

Our legacy queue in Farrowdesk drops jobs under concurrent enqueue. To reproduce: start two workers, enqueue 500 jobs via the admin CLI, then restart one worker mid-batch. Roughly 2% of jobs vanish without retry. Migration to Relayline is planned for the next sprint. Staging verification calls require the bearer token below.

login token, bagug-kafop: eyJhbGciOiJIUzI1NiIsInR5cCI6IkpXVCJ9.eyJzdWIiOiIcMLov2In0.Z5RLDIfp

Subject: Landlord Site Audit — Thursday

Hello everyone,

Welcome to Bramleigh Point! Our landlord, Orvell Estates, is conducting a site audit this Thursday. Please keep corridors clear, wear your badge visibly, and tidy desks before leaving Wednesday. Auditors may ask to see fire exits, so don't prop doors. New starters who haven't received a permanent badge yet should use the temporary access code below.

badge for fafop-fajof: bdg-Z-47

Subject: Brindlefort build cut-over finished

Hello plugin authors,

We have completed the migration of the Brindlefort build to our hermetic build system, Cloistern. All toolchains are now pinned and fetched from the sealed artifact mirror, so builds no longer depend on machine-local compilers. Plugin builds must declare every input explicitly; undeclared reads will fail the sandbox check. Rebuild against the new pipeline this week. The build service currently uses these settings.

service settings:
PRAWYN_PIN=9848
PRAWYN_METRICS_HOST=metrics.prawyn.lumicworks.corp
PRAWYN_LOG_LEVEL=warn
PRAWYN_TENANT=pelius

## Gatewing Rate Limits

As discussed last sync, the Gatewing internal gateway now enforces per-service token buckets instead of global counters. Each upstream registered in the Larkspur mesh gets its own refill rate and burst ceiling, and throttled calls return a retry hint header. Defaults were chosen from two weeks of traffic replay on the staging cluster in Fennwick. Overrides go in the service manifest, not the gateway config. The current tuning constants are as follows.

tuning table, kajog-kawef:
PRIORITIES = {
    "kelox": 870,
    "kasix": 89,
    "eliax": 988,
}